Upheaval in Zambia Super League Coaching: Beston Chambeshi’s Future Uncertain

The Zambia Super League is bracing itself for a potential exodus of coaching talent in the coming weeks, with several high-profile changes on the horizon. Among the most notable moves, Coach Beston Chambeshi’s future hangs in the balance as he contemplates offers from Forest Rangers and Napsa Stars. This impending coaching shake-up promises to reshape the league’s dynamics. It’s worth noting that these insights come from sources close to Bola Yapa Zed, providing an inside perspective on the unfolding events.
Coach Beston Chambeshi, a respected figure in Zambian football, is currently at the center of attention. He finds himself at a crossroads with offers from both Forest Rangers and Napsa Stars on the table. His final destination will depend on the agreements reached with the respective clubs. As of now, Forest Rangers have opted for their first assistant coach to step in on an interim basis as they await a final decision and the settling of dust before making an official move.
Napsa Stars is also set for a significant change in leadership. Coach Perry Mutapa is reportedly on the verge of being dismissed due to the team’s lackluster performance. Close sources, particularly those close to Bola Yapa Zed, suggest that Mutapa is likely to return to Forest Rangers, where he has previously made his mark. To replace Mutapa, coach Chris Kaunda is expected to step into the role of Napsa Stars’ head coach. The coaching shuffle doesn’t end there, as Mutapa’s former assistant, Sipho Mumbi, has already left his position to join Coach Ian Bakala at Nkana.
